Grow Heirloom Pumpkins - Plant Jack-Be-Little Pumpkin Seeds

Tiny, decorative and even edible, Jack-be-Little Pumpkins are perfect for little hands or little spaces. Vines are compact and will spread only about 10-15 feet. Miniature Jack-Be-Little Pumpkins are uniform and smooth skinned, usually measuring about 3 inches across and 2 inches high. Once harvested these pumpkins are long lasting, making them perfect for seasonal decorations and a favorite among crafters and florists.

Pumpkin Seeds - Jack Be Little FAQs

What type of seed is Jack Be Little Pumpkin?

Jack Be Little Pumpkin is classified as heirloom seed and open pollinated seed.

How big will Jack Be Little Pumpkin get?

Jack Be Little Pumpkin grows to 4 inches.

What is the flavor profile of Jack Be Little Pumpkin?

Jack Be Little Pumpkin has a flavor profile described as not typically eaten, mild, slightly sweet, and mealy texture.
